    Middlesex County lottery player wins $50K playing Powerball

    By Brad Wadlow, MyCentralJersey.com,

    1 days ago

    https://img.particlenews.com/image.php?url=1AURIS_0vp5WlOo00

    A lottery player in Middlesex County won $50,000 in the Wednesday, Sept. 25, Powerball drawing.

    The winning ticket was sold at Quick Chek #62 in South Plainfield, 317 Durham Ave. The winning numbers were: 2, 26, 45, 46 and 52. The Red Powerball number was 21.

    Players select five numbers between 1 and 69 and one Powerball number between 1 and 26. Drawings are broadcast live at 10:59 p.m. ET every Monday, Wednesday and Saturday from the Florida Lottery draw studio in Tallahassee, Florida. Drawings are also live streamed on Powerball.com .
